资讯动态 动态类型全部媒体报道项目进展周边活动人员招募水安全资讯找到 32 条相关内容Alumni Spotlight: Charlene Ren, Environmental EngineerAs a Tata Fellow from 2013-2015, Xiaoyuan “Charlene” Ren worked on a project treating wastewater in Indian paper mills while earning her Master’s degree in Civil & Environmental Engineering at MIT. Now she’s turning her attention to her native country of China. Charlene has founded an NGO, MyH2O, that is trying to extend access to clean water in China by creating and training a youth-led water testing network. For this work she’s been named a 2016 Echoing Green Global Fellow.
